use crate::{error_response::ErrorResponse, track::Track};
use serde::{de::Error, Deserialize, Deserializer, Serialize};
use serde_json::Value;
#[derive(Serialize, Deserialize)]
#[serde(untagged)]
pub enum RecentTracksResponse {
Error(ErrorResponse),
RecentTracksPage(RecentTracksPage),
}
#[derive(Serialize, Debug, Clone)]
pub struct RecentTracksPage {
pub total_tracks: u64,
pub tracks: Vec<Track>,
}
impl<'de> Deserialize<'de> for RecentTracksPage {
fn deserialize<D>(deserializer: D) -> Result<Self, D::Error>
where
D: Deserializer<'de>,
{
let raw_data: Value = Deserialize::deserialize(deserializer)?;
let raw_recent_tracks = raw_data
.get("recenttracks")
.ok_or_else(|| D::Error::missing_field("recenttracks"))?
.as_object()
.ok_or_else(|| D::Error::custom("Field recenttracks is not an object"))?;
let total_tracks = raw_recent_tracks
.get("@attr")
.ok_or_else(|| D::Error::missing_field("@attr"))?
.as_object()
.ok_or_else(|| D::Error::custom("Field @attr is not an object"))?
.get("total")
.ok_or_else(|| D::Error::missing_field("total"))?
.as_str()
.ok_or_else(|| D::Error::custom("Field total is not a string"))?
.parse::<u64>()
.map_err(|e| D::Error::custom(format!("Failed to parse total: {e}")))?;
let tracks = raw_recent_tracks
.get("track")
.ok_or_else(|| D::Error::missing_field("track"))?
.as_array()
.ok_or_else(|| D::Error::custom("Field track is not an array"))?
.iter()
.map(|t| {
serde_json::from_value::<Track>(t.clone())
.map_err(|e| D::Error::custom(format!("Cannot deserialize track: {e}")))
})
.collect::<Result<Vec<Track>, D::Error>>()?;
Ok(RecentTracksPage {
total_tracks,
tracks,
})
}
}
